We found this mural last month in Cambridge, Massachusetts during a visit with family. It was a block of beauty by my standard, an ode to American cinema.


The news makes my head hurt lately. Never mind the personal challenges we face in our lives, whatever yours may be.


Do you know what’s helped me? Stories. Not my story, or real stories in the news, or viral content on social media. I’m talking about stories of the past and present - movies, plays, books and songs - that give me perspective and a moment to be transported.


If you haven’t heard of the AFI 100, it’s a list of the 100 greatest movies of all time according to the American Film Institute. Many of my friends hadn’t heard of it. My favorites so far: On the Waterfront starring a charming Marlin Brando and Raging Bull. Yes, Toy Story also made the list.


I promise, there’s nothing better than taking the time during a busy week... giving yourself two hours to get lost in worlds that aren’t our own.
